    Hi there! I recently upgraded to a Treo from a Sony Clie myself, and I have to tell you, I had some problems getting my stuff into the Treo. I suppose my problem was that, somehow, I ended up syncing both devices with the same user name, and that is ONE BIG NO-NO. Eventually, what I had to do was to place the backup files in my PC in the Quick Install tool, and that worked. Good luck!

    I recommend getting a large SD card for any applications that support reading from that media. The Treo 650 has limited memory and I have had it get stuck in a loop if the memory get too low. I have a few 1GB cards that I swap between. If you use Documents To Go, they have a utility to move their memory intensive applications to a memory card.
